Hunger Action Week 2013: Take a Stand Against Hunger in Your Community

Posted on 3/25/2013 by Danny Done

Every day, many of our financially vulnerable families, friends, and neighbors struggle to make ends meet and put food on the table. In King County, hunger is real: 1 in 5 kids is at risk of hunger and 1 in 6 adults worries where their next meal will come from. But to solve hunger, we must first understand how it affects our community and what we can do about it.
